The Connacht Hotel has been recognised for its outstanding commitment to sustainability after achieving the prestigious Gold Award from Green Tourism, the world's leading sustainability certification programme for the tourism and hospitality industry.
The Gold accreditation, awarded following the hotel's 2026 assessment, recognises The Connacht Hotel's ongoing commitment to operating responsibly and embedding sustainable practices throughout every aspect of the business.
As part of a global community of more than 2,600 tourism and hospitality businesses committed to creating a more sustainable future, The Connacht Hotel underwent a comprehensive assessment by Green Tourism's expert team, who are trained to IEMA standards. The hotel was evaluated against 15 sustainability criteria spanning the three key pillars of People, Places and Planet, with the Gold Award acknowledging the significant progress made in reducing environmental impact while creating positive outcomes for guests, employees and the local community.
